Turin: Guarino Guarini, the chapel of Holy Shroud, 1667-90
The drum culminates in the dome, this is formed by a series of layers, each composed of flattened arch rest on the tops of the lowest arches, and this process is repeated six times
-
Turin: Guarino Guarini, San Lorenzo, 1668-80
San Lorenzo is an octagon, to which is added a small oval choir. Also in this building the most important part is the dome. The dome composed of ribs crossing each other so as to form a kind of network and leaving an octagonal space in the centre.
